What's Happening?
The International Hydropower Association (IHA) reports that global hydropower capacity reached 1,469 GW by the end of 2025, with pumped storage capacity surpassing 200 GW. This growth highlights hydropower's evolving role in the global energy transition,
as countries increasingly rely on flexible renewable generation and long-duration energy storage to enhance energy security and decarbonization efforts. The report emphasizes the strategic importance of hydropower in providing grid stability and supporting the integration of variable renewables like solar and wind power.

What's Next?
The IHA predicts that global pumped storage capacity will double in the next 15 years, with potential for further growth if supportive policies are implemented. Governments are expected to prioritize hydropower in their energy strategies, recognizing its role in enhancing energy security and supporting the transition to a low-carbon economy. The ongoing development of hydropower projects worldwide, particularly in China and India, will continue to drive capacity expansion and innovation in the sector.
